This is a double question. Part 1: 5(2x - 4) = 30. Solve for x Part 2: 5x + 3 - x + 2 = 41. Solve for x. I will mark Brainliest
Ainat [17]

Answer:

see below

Step-by-step explanation:

Part 1: 5(2x - 4) = 30.

Distribute

10x -20 = 30

Add 20 to each side

10x-20+20 =30+20

10x = 50

Divide by 10

10x/10 = 50/10

x =5

Part 2: 5x + 3 - x + 2 = 41

Combine like terms

4x +5 = 41

Subtract 5 from each side

4x+5-5 = 41-5

4x = 36

Divide by 4

4x/4 = 36/4

x = 9

Sonji correctly added 2p+1/p-8 and 3p-3/4p and got 8p^2+4p+3p-27p+24/(p-8)(4p). What is the simplified sum?
RUDIKE [14]

Answer:

The simplified sum is \frac{11p^{2}-23p+24}{(p-8)4p}

Step-by-step explanation:  

we have

\frac{2p+1}{p-8}+\frac{3p-3}{4p}=\frac{4p(2p+1)+(p-8)(3p-3)}{(p-8)4p}\\ \\=\frac{8p^{2}+4p+3p^{2}-3p-24p+24}{(p-8)4p}\\ \\ =\frac{11p^{2}-23p+24}{(p-8)4p}
